nix/home/modules/hyprpaper.nix
2026-02-11 14:42:25 -05:00

22 lines
376 B
Nix

{
pkgs,
lib,
...
}:
let
isNixOS = builtins.pathExists /etc/NIXOS;
in
{
home.packages = lib.mkIf isNixOS [ pkgs.hyprpaper ];
services.hyprpaper = {
enable = true;
package = lib.mkIf (!isNixOS) null;
settings = {
preload = [ "~/img/screen/wallpaper.jpg" ];
wallpaper = [ ",~/img/screen/wallpaper.jpg" ];
splash = false;
};
};
}